Beausejour Duffau 2007
St Emilion, Premier Grand Cru Classé B

The 2007 Beauséjour Duffau-Lagarrosse has a sedate bouquet with brambly black fruit with redcurrant and a touch of dried fig lending sweetness. The palate is medium-bodied with tannin that have softened dramatically in recent years. It feels grainy in texture with a rather fluffy, gravelly finish that is missing some backbone. Easy-drinking Saint Emilion but still, it is nicely crafted considering the growing season. Tasted March 2015. Score: 87 Neal Martin, Wine Advocate, RobertParker.com Maturity: 2015-2020 30 June 2017 |
